package meta
import (
"fmt"
"strings"
"github.com/ATenderholt/rainbow-test/terraform/conns"
"github.com/aws/aws-sdk-go/aws/endpoints"
"github.com/hashicorp/terraform-plugin-sdk/v2/helper/schema"
)
func DataSourceRegion() *schema.Resource {
return &schema.Resource{
Read: dataSourceRegionRead,
Schema: map[string]*schema.Schema{
"name": {
Type: schema.TypeString,
Optional: true,
Computed: true,
},
"endpoint": {
Type: schema.TypeString,
Optional: true,
Computed: true,
},
"description": {
Type: schema.TypeString,
Computed: true,
},
},
}
}
func dataSourceRegionRead(d *schema.ResourceData, meta interface{}) error {
providerRegion := meta.(*conns.AWSClient).Region
var region *endpoints.Region
if v, ok := d.GetOk("endpoint"); ok {
endpoint := v.(string)
matchingRegion, err := FindRegionByEndpoint(endpoint)
if err != nil {
return err
}
region = matchingRegion
}
if v, ok := d.GetOk("name"); ok {
name := v.(string)
matchingRegion, err := FindRegionByName(name)
if err != nil {
return err
}
if region != nil && region.ID() != matchingRegion.ID() {
return fmt.Errorf("multiple regions matched; use additional constraints to reduce matches to a single region")
}
region = matchingRegion
}
// Default to provider current region if no other filters matched
if region == nil {
matchingRegion, err := FindRegionByName(providerRegion)
if err != nil {
return err
}
region = matchingRegion
}
d.SetId(region.ID())
regionEndpointEc2, err := region.ResolveEndpoint(endpoints.Ec2ServiceID)
if err != nil {
return err
}
d.Set("endpoint", strings.TrimPrefix(regionEndpointEc2.URL, "https://"))
d.Set("name", region.ID())
d.Set("description", region.Description())
return nil
}
func FindRegionByEndpoint(endpoint string) (*endpoints.Region, error) {
for _, partition := range endpoints.DefaultPartitions() {
for _, region := range partition.Regions() {
regionEndpointEc2, err := region.ResolveEndpoint(endpoints.Ec2ServiceID)
if err != nil {
return nil, err
}
if strings.TrimPrefix(regionEndpointEc2.URL, "https://") == endpoint {
return ®ion, nil
}
}
}
return nil, fmt.Errorf("region not found for endpoint %q", endpoint)
}
func FindRegionByName(name string) (*endpoints.Region, error) {
for _, partition := range endpoints.DefaultPartitions() {
for _, region := range partition.Regions() {
if region.ID() == name {
return ®ion, nil
}
}
}
return nil, fmt.Errorf("region not found for name %q", name)
}
